Over the past few days, we've been hearing a lot about a verbal altercation between WWE Champion Brock Lesnar and NXT Champion Matt Riddle before the Royal Rumble PPV. Apparently, The Beast made it clear to Riddle that they'll never work together but he's not giving up on the match! 

"I've been waiting a long time to get in a Royal Rumble," Riddle says in the video below which was released today by the WWE Performance Center account. "The Royal Rumble is my favorite pay per view since I was a little kid. It's my birthday tomorrow. It's just one of those things, you know?"
 
"I really wanted to get my hands on Brock," he continued. "I saw him throwing everybody around. I don't care what he does or what anybody does. I don't care if he wants the match or not. I'm gonna get it. I don't care. It's not up to him. I don't like being told, 'no', especially when I work as hard as I do."

"Trust me. I guarantee you. I guarantee you. I get my hands on him, and I make that match happen, and I take his career. I promise. I promise."
Honestly, it's beginning to feel like WWE may be building to something here but when it will happen is impossible to say right now.

With any luck, it will be sooner rather than later...
